The Buzz on Excel Links Not Working

Excel Links Not Working - The Facts


Other features. The AGGREGATE feature is a powerful and also efficient means of computing 19 different techniques of aggregating information (such as,, and ).


Beginning in Excel 2007, you need to use,, and also functions instead of the DFunctions. To boost efficiency for VBA macros, explicitly turn off the performance that is not called for while your code executes.


The complying with capability can usually be shut off while your VBA macro carries out: Shut off display updating. If is set to, Excel does not redraw the screen. While your code runs, the screen updates swiftly, and also it is usually not required for the individual to see each upgrade. Updating the screen once, after the code performs, enhances efficiency.


If is readied to, Excel does not present the standing bar. The standing bar setup is different from the display upgrading establishing to make sure that you can still present the standing of the existing procedure also while the display is not upgrading. If you do not need to show the status of every operation, transforming off the standing bar while your code runs likewise enhances efficiency.


Examine This Report about Excel Links Not Working


If is readied to, Excel just computes the workbook when the customer explicitly starts the estimation. In automated computation setting, Excel figures out when to calculate. Every time a cell worth that is related to a formula changes, Excel recalculates the formula. If you switch over the calculation setting to manual, you can wait up until all the cells related to the formula are updated before recalculating the workbook.


Shut off occasions. If is readied to, Excel does not increase events. If there are add-ins paying attention for Excel events, those add-ins consume sources on the computer as they tape the events. If it is not essential for the add-in to tape the events that happen while your code runs, shutting off events boosts performance.




If is readied to, Excel does not display page breaks. excel links not working. It's not needed to recalculate web page breaks while your code runs, as well as determining the page breaks after the code performs boosts performance. Vital Remember to restore this functionality to its original state after your code implements. The adhering to example reveals the performance that you can switch off while your VBA macro sites performs.


Screen, Updating standing, Bar, State = Application. Present, Condition, Bar calc, State = Application. Computation events, State = Application.


5 Easy Facts About Excel Links Not Working Shown


Calculation = xl, Computation, Manual Application. Enable, Events = False' Note: this is a sheet-level setup. Screen, Modernizing = screen, Update, State Application.


Computation = calc, State Application. Enable, Events = events, State' Note: this is a sheet-level setup Active, Sheet. Show, Web Page, Breaks = display, Web page, Breaks, State Optimize your code by explicitly minimizing the number of times data is moved in between Excel as well as your code. Rather of looping with cells individually to get or establish a worth, get or set the worths in the whole range of cells in one line, utilizing an alternative including a two-dimensional variety to shop values as needed.


The following code example reveals non-optimized code that loopholes via cells one at a time to get as well as establish the worths of cells A1: C10000. These cells do not contain formulas. Dim Data, Variety as Variety Dim Irow as Long Dim Icol as Integer Dim My, Var as Dual Establish Information, Range=Range("A1: C10000") For Irow=1 to 10000 For icol=1 to 3' Read the values from the Excel grid 30,000 times.


excel links not workingexcel links not working
My, Var=My, Var * Myvar' Create the values back right into the Excel grid 30,000 times. Data, Variety(Irow, Icol)=My, Var End If Following Icol Next Irow The following code instance shows enhanced code that uses a variety to get as well as establish the values of cells A1: C10000 all at the exact same time. These cells do not include solutions.


What Does Excel Links Not Working Mean?


excel links not workingexcel links not working
excel links not workingexcel links not working
Data, Range = Array("A1: C10000"). Value2 For Irow = 1 To 10000 For Icol = 1 To 3 My, Var = Data, Range(Irow, Icol) If My, Var > 0 After That' Adjustment the values in the array. My, Var=My, Var * Myvar Information, Variety(Irow, Icol) = My, Var End If Next the original source Icol Next Irow' Create all the worths back into the array simultaneously.




Value2 = Information, Range returns the formatted worth of a cell. This is slow, can shed precision, and also can trigger errors when calling worksheet features.


The following code examples contrast the 2 techniques. The adhering to code example shows non-optimized code that chooses each Forming on the active sheet and also changes the text to "Hey there".


Forms. Count Active, Sheet. Shapes(i). Select Option. Text="Hello There" why not try this out Next i The adhering to code example shows maximized code that references each Shape straight as well as alters the message to "Hello". For i = 0 To Active, Sheet. Forms. Count Active, Sheet. Forms(i). Text, Impact. Text="Hi" Following i The complying with is a checklist of extra efficiency optimizations you can use in your VBA code: Return results by assigning a selection directly to a.

Leave a Reply

Your email address will not be published. Required fields are marked *